The advantages of selling your completed development are that youll make a profit straight away, pay off the development loan quickly and be able to move onto your next project with a bit more experience and money up your sleeve. The project is typically financed at this stage with construction financing or another round of short-term bridge financing until the project reaches a threshold called stabilization, which is typically defined as a certain occupancy level (perhaps 90% or better) for a certain duration (perhaps three consecutive months). In a retail build-to-suit, a developer secures a long-term credit tenant, such as a McDonalds or Walgreens, and develops a property to suit that tenant.
